Drug Addiction Treatment: Expert Care for a Healthier Future

It is a chronic disease of the brain reward system characterized by compulsive substance use despite negative outcomes. The brain works differently because of it, rendering a person not in a position to control their behaviors. Persistence Prevails: $183 Million in Reimbursement Over Next Ten Years

Current Medicare laws, along with a stagnant Medicare wage index, resulted in major inequities in hospital Medicare reimbursement. Hospitals in larger urban areas receive more reimbursement than those in rural areas, even though all hospitals pay the same amount for wages, equipment and supplies.
